Ealing, a place of enduring gentility, offers a particular charm to those who wander its thoroughfares. It lies 12.1 km west of London (from London: bearing 273°T, OS grid TQ 178 807). The broad avenues, lined with handsome Victorian and Edwardian residences, speak of a prosperous past, their stucco facades catching the afternoon sun with a pale, dignified glow. Ealing Broadway, the bustling heart of this district, hums with a quiet energy, a place where the scent of freshly baked bread from a local bakery might mingle with the fainter, more exotic perfume of spices from a nearby grocer. The very air seems to possess a certain clarity, perhaps owing to the generous scattering of green spaces that punctuate the urban fabric, offering a breathing room for the discerning Londoner. Here, one might encounter the dignified silhouette of Ealing Town Hall, a testament to civic pride, or the more modest, yet equally significant, presence of its parish church, its spire reaching towards the heavens with a quiet aspiration.
